We plan to have 765 at Trainfest assuming her July completion goal is met. Be on the lookout for excursion announcements within the next couple of months. It seems that late summer and fall of this year will be busy for the locomotive. Several excursions are tentatively scheduled and contracts will be signed as soon as a completion date can be guaranteed. Excursions are also in the works for 2005 which should prove very interesting. The group will spend some time next winter installing cab signals in preparation for the 2005 events. Although things are tough out there for mainline steam, 765 has an excellent track record and our Chief Operations Officer Rich melvin is amazing when it comes getting the support of railroad officials. There have actually been excursions in the planning stages for the past few years. You certainly don't spend this kind of money on such a thorough rebuild unless you know you can run when you are finished. |

Here's the straight story, although David hit the mark very closely. 2004 OPERATIONS - AUGUST - SEPTEMBER: We intend to have the 765 ready for participation in the Ohio Central TrainFestival 2004 on July 31-31 and Aug. 1. Additional operations are in the works on the Ohio Central for September. We'll post the details once we firm up the plans and iron out the business details. 2004 OPERATIONS - OCTOBER: We're not ready to go public with specifics on this yet, but the 765 will run several trips in Indiana in October. We'll post the details when everything is in place for these events and the tickets are ready to be sold. 2004 OPERATIONS - NOVEMBER: There may be a couple more weekends of trips in Ohio before we go home for the winter. Details in a few months. When the 765 is ready for the road, we intend to seek Amtrak approval to operate the 765 under their operating authority, just as Steve Sandberg has done with the 261. New River Trains? Not in 2004. 2005 OPERATIONS: Several interesting venues are under discussion for 2005. It is far to early to discuss the details, but there are plans in the works now to operate the 765 in 2005 in some new places...and some previously visited places.
